I had this problem too. In order to get back into FCP, you should dump your preferences by going into the folder Library/Preferences, and then deleting the file com.apple.FinalCutPro.plist and the folder Final Cut Pro User Data.
Then, once you’re in FCP, you’ll have to reset your preferences, including the scratch disks. What caused the problem in the first place, at least for me, was that my Thumbnail Cache scratch disk was set to a remote drive. Make sure this in particular is set to a folder on the MacHD, and FCP should open normally again.